2012-08-22 192 views
1

我總共有2張圖片。我只想顯示第一個,隱藏第二個。使用jQuery旋轉圖像。點擊交換/更改圖片

然後,當我點擊圖像時,它會將圖像替換爲第二張圖像,然後再次點擊回到第一個圖像,在循環中,每次點擊都會不斷地交換圖像,如1,2,1 ,2,1,2等等。

乾杯

+0

請分享到目前爲止,你已經嘗試了什麼。 – Blazemonger

回答

1

HTML:

<img src="URL" id="image1" /> 
<img src="URL" id="image2" style='display:none;'/> 

的jQuery:

$("#image1").click(function (event) { 
     $(this).hide(); 
     $("#image2").show(); 
    }); 
$("#image2").click(function (event) { 
     $(this).hide(); 
     $("#image1").show(); 
    }); 
0

你可以試試這個使用jQuery的CSS功能等;

$('.image').toggle(
function() { 
    $('#img1').css({ 'display':'none' }); 
    $('#img2').css({ 'display':'inline' }); 
}, function() { 
    $('#img2').css({ 'display':'none' }); 
    $('#img1').css({ 'display':'inline' }); 
}); 

Here是一個工作現場演示